The first case in #Nunavut has come back negative after being tested at an accredited lab in Ontario. However, the case will remain a presumptive positive and thus remain in our dataset.
cbc.ca/news/canada/no…
"We may never know for sure whether the individual had a barely detectable case of COVID-19," said Dr. Michael Patterson, Nunavut’s Chief Public Health Officer.
